Financial Assistance for Military Families
American Red Cross
At Financial Assistance for Military Families located in Jennings, LA, we are dedicated to providing essential financial support to military families in times of urgent need. In partnership with military aid societies, we offer reliable assistance around the clock, ensuring that help is available every day of the year. Our program covers a variety of emergency needs, including funds for emergency travel, burial expenses, and critical provisions like emergency food and shelter. While we facilitate the application process, the military aid society determines both eligibility and the specific financial aid package that best meets individual needs. Food for Families / Food for Seniors
Catholic Charities Archdiocese of New Orleans (CCANO)
At Food for Families / Food for Seniors in Jennings, LA, we are dedicated to supporting the community through essential food assistance programs tailored for seniors in need. Operated by Catholic Charities Archdiocese of New Orleans (CCANO), our initiative provides monthly nutritional food boxes filled with vital staple items such as canned meats, fruits, vegetables, grains, and dairy products, ensuring that our seniors receive balanced nutrition. In addition to the food boxes, we empower participants with nutrition education, equipping them with helpful information on meal preparation, caloric intake, and budgeting for grocery shopping, all aimed at promoting healthier lifestyles. Nurse-Family Partnership - Region 5 MIECHV
Louisiana Department of Health
The Nurse-Family Partnership - Region 5 MIECHV in Jennings, LA is dedicated to enhancing the health and well-being of pregnant women and parenting families with young children through a free, voluntary home visiting program. This initiative, part of the Louisiana Department of Health’s Bureau of Family Health, connects families with skilled registered nurses and parent educators who offer tailored education, guidance, and access to vital community resources. By providing home-based coaching on health education, positive parenting techniques, and personal goal-setting, our program empowers families to thrive. Participants benefit from greater economic self-sufficiency, early detection of developmental delays, and overall improved health outcomes for their children. Farm & Food Systems Fellowship
Allegheny Mountain Institute (AMI)
The Farm & Food Systems Fellowship in Jennings, LA, empowers individuals to champion a food system that is just, sustainable, and inclusive. This transformative program offers hands-on training in organic food systems and equips Fellows to become leaders in food education and advocacy. Participants engage in diverse initiatives such as growing and distributing crops on market-style farms, implementing health-focused educational sessions, and maintaining community gardens that enhance food access. By integrating food and ecological literacy into local schools and supporting farmers markets and direct-to-consumer programs, Fellows play a crucial role in building a vibrant local food economy. The Fellowship includes an immersive six-month residential experience at AMI’s Allegheny Farm Campus, followed by a year of impactful community projects with regional non-profit organizations. To promote accessibility, the program is tuition-free, inviting applicants to apply by March for the experience that typically runs from May to October.

Women, Infants, and Children Program (WIC)
Louisiana Department of Health
The Louisiana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) Program in Jennings, LA, is dedicated to empowering pregnant women, new mothers, and young children with essential nutrition assistance and education. Our mission is to ensure that low-income families have access to healthy foods and vital resources that promote well-being and healthy development. Through our program, eligible participants receive supplemental nutritious foods, personalized nutrition education, and valuable breastfeeding support. Additionally, we provide referrals to crucial healthcare services to enhance the overall health of mothers and their children.
